Handover note — Crumbwheel order cutoffs.

Welcome aboard. The bakery cutoff rule in Crumbwheel closes same-day orders at 14:00 local to each storefront, not UTC — this has bitten us twice. Holiday overrides live in the calendar service and take precedence silently, so always check there first when a cutoff looks wrong. To unlock the calendar service's admin console after a restart, enter the recovery passphrase below.

vault phrase of bagap-bahaf = silion-pelox-sorox-casdor-quenwyn-fraax-eliox-praael-kelion-quenvan-kasox-rusael-norius-belvan

Subject: Budget request — Pellgrove expansion

Executive team,

Requesting £340k incremental budget for the Pellgrove rollout: £190k engineering, £90k field operations, £60k contingency. Without it we slip the Norwich-of-ours, Ashdene, launch by two quarters and concede ground to Corvid Labs. Payback modelled at 14 months on conservative uptake. Full workings are in the planning folder; I'll take questions at Thursday's session. The board-level context for this ask is set out immediately below.

— Tamsin

internal memo for bahap-yagug: Headcount on the Ulaix team goes from 3 to 100 by the end of January. Gross margin on Ulaix came in at 10 percent against a plan of 15 percent.

Changed defaults in Splitfork, our assignment service. Bucketing now uses sticky hashing per account instead of per session, and the holdout slice grew from 2% to 5%. Callers relying on session-level reassignment must opt in explicitly. Review the diff against the new baseline; the updated default configuration is listed below.

config for tagep-kajof:
[casir]
port = 6379
region = south-1
host = casir.paliqdyn.example
team = tamax
timeout_ms = 250
retries = 2

Runbook: Scanhawk barcode scanner integration. If scans stop posting, restart the bridge daemon on the warehouse gateway, then verify event flow in the Tallyline dashboard. Mismatched firmware causes silent drops; check version first. The bridge authenticates to the internal inventory service on startup and fails closed if the credential is stale. Current key follows.

app token of bahaf-tajeg = zpat23_SjjsllwiLmXbtS65veZaV47